
Burnham Park is a big open space consisting of concrete roads, lawns, a man-made lake, and lots of trees. You can rent bicycles, tricycles, and makeshift um... car-cycles? The roads are evenly paved so it's smooth riding all theoughout.
There are vendors in the park selling snacks like this ice cream sandwich. Generous scoopfuls of your ice cream flavor of choice are stuffed in between a soft burger bun. You can also opt to have your ice cream in a cone.
This is the man-made lake located in the middle of Burnham Park which I remember so well from my childhood days. You can rent boats and hire a boatman if you want, or you could do the paddling yourself.
Baguio's cool climate makes walking in the park a relaxing and leisurely activity. It's especially nice during breezy days.
